ABOUT THE ARTIST
I enjoy bringing realistic details to life through the unique medium of wood stain. Details seem to be lost in the rush of our everyday life so I try to capture the breath of my viewers with my artwork and cause a deliberate pause to focus on the beauty around us. I hand-draw each piece directly onto the wood and use black wood stain with only q-tips and/or cloths on my fingertips to do all the shading work of each piece. The high contrast look of the black stain on the sepia tone of the natural wood creates a soft yet stunning statement piece ready to match any space. I have chosen to only create one-of-a-kind originals with no prints to increase the value of my work for each individual customer.
ABOUT THE ART
Each image is free-hand drawn on poplar wood and stained with black wood stain using only q-tips and cloths on my fingertips. Each piece is clear-coated for protection. The result is a high contrast yet soft, sepia tone original.
